Heidenheim’s Past Season and Preseason Performance
Last season, Heidenheim found themselves in a precarious position, narrowly avoiding relegation from the Bundesliga. They secured their top-flight status through a playoff battle against Elversberg, highlighting a season of struggle rather than triumph.
Their preseason preparations have been notably limited and somewhat unconventional, featuring only three friendly matches. Despite the restricted schedule, they managed to secure victories against Wacker (2-0), Ingolstadt (3-2), and Parma (2-1).
Lack of Squad Reinforcement and Managerial Challenges
Heidenheim’s management appears to have overlooked past deficiencies, failing to make any significant additions to strengthen the squad during the summer transfer window. Even minor tactical transfers were sparse. While the core squad from last season was retained, this same group was involved in a fight to stay up. Coach Frank Schmidt has arguably already extracted the maximum potential from these players, suggesting a challenging road ahead without fresh talent.
DFB-Pokal Result and Injury Woes
Just a week prior, the hosts recorded a comfortable 5-0 victory over the relatively modest Balinger in the DFB-Pokal’s Round of 1/32. However, with their opponent coming from the fourth division, this result offers little insight into their readiness for the demanding Bundesliga season.
Further compounding the team’s difficulties, Coach Schmidt will be without four key players for the upcoming encounter: Keller, Feller, Beck, and Pieringer, significantly impacting his selection options.

Wolfsburg’s Ambitions and New Leadership
Wolfsburg has not featured in European competitions or contended for league medals for a considerable period. The previous season continued this trend, prompting the appointment of Paul Simonis as the new head coach, tasked with steering the team towards renewed success.
Challenging Preseason and Defensive Concerns
The “Wolves'” preseason campaign was far from ideal. After an initial 4-3 victory over Magdeburg, they subsequently suffered four consecutive defeats: Espanyol (0-1), Feyenoord (0-4), and Brighton (1-2, 1-2). This sequence of results raises significant questions about their form heading into the new season.
Their defensive performance is particularly alarming, having conceded 12 goals across these five preseason fixtures. While the attack managed six goals, four of these came in a single match against Magdeburg, indicating a potential lack of consistent offensive threat against stronger opposition.
DFB-Pokal Success and Promising Signings
In their first official match, Wolfsburg dominated Hemelingen with a resounding 9-0 victory in the DFB-Pokal. This commanding performance was essential, as any less convincing result might have immediately put Paul Simonis under pressure.
On a more optimistic note, the club secured three promising signings: Aaron Zehnter (from Paderborn), Vini Souza (Sheffield United), and Jesper Lindstrom (Napoli). These new additions are expected to bolster the squad’s quality.
Extensive Injury List for Wolfsburg
A major challenge for Simonis is an extensive injury list, with eight players currently sidelined: Paredes, Amoura, Skov, Wind, Vavro, Rogerio, Lindstrom, and Olsen. This considerable number of absentees will undoubtedly complicate his efforts to select a strong starting eleven and test the team’s depth.
